What is Pain that Alters?

Pain that alters, also known as chronic pain, is a complex and multifaceted condition that affects millions of people worldwide. Unlike acute pain, which is a normal response to injury or illness and typically resolves once the underlying cause is addressed, chronic pain persists for weeks, months, or even years. This persistent pain can significantly impact a person’s quality of life, causing physical, emotional, and psychological distress.

Chronic pain can result from various sources, including injury, disease, and even psychological factors. It can manifest in different forms, such as sharp, throbbing, or burning sensations, and may be localized or widespread. Understanding the nature of pain that alters is crucial for effective management and treatment, as it often requires a multidisciplinary approach involving medical professionals, therapists, and support networks.
